Java jd decompiler.

use jd-cli to de-compile the jar , and with the log option, e.g. jd-cli target.jar -od jar_result -g ALL. check the output log and find out which block.class file block the de-compile proccess. if there is, then remove it from the target.jar and then re-run the jd-cli again. You can manually copy/paste the block.class source code from jd-gui.

Java jd decompiler. Things To Know About Java jd decompiler.

Here are the best Java Decompilers that you can use. Also, Read: 5 Best IDE for Java Programmers. Best Java Decompilers. 1. JD Project. Java Decompiler project was majorly developed for decompiling Java 5 bytecode and other versions that came later. The decompiler can be used on three major operating systems which are …* This is a Copyleft license that gives the user the right to use, * copy and modify the code freely for non-commercial purposes. */ package org. jd. gui. util. net; import org. jd. gui. util. exception. 2) Close all open editor tabs before opening a class file. Otherwise it's easy to get an outdated editor tab from a previous attempt. 3) Open the class file in the "Java Class File Editor" (not "Java Class File Viewer"). Use "Open With" in the context menu to get the right editor. I have used JD-Eclipse Realign with success on Eclipse. Believe me, it does make a difference to debug decompiled code with source line alignment. Share. ... Yes there are java decompilers available on internet, both paid and unpaid. I am currently using one called 'DJ java decompiler', which provides a free trial version, just google it. ...Simply drag and drop to decompile and search Java Jars & Android APKs; File format support for: Class, Jar, XAPK, APK, DEX, WAR, JSP, Image Resources, Text Resources & More; 6 Built-in Java decompilers: Krakatau, CFR, Procyon, FernFlower, JADX, JD-GUI; 3 Built-in Bytecode disassemblers, including 2 …

Jad main features. Jad is a Java decompiler, i.e. program that reads one or more Java class files and converts them into Java source files which can be compiled again. Jad is a 100% pure C++ program and it generally works several times faster than decompilers written in Java.

Dec 24, 2020 · Fig 1: Enhanced Class Decompiler configuration. To see ECD in action, first download and prepare the example code as described in Download the source code at the end of this article. Set a breakpoint at line 13 in QuadDemo.java and start it running: Fig 2: Ready to step into method with missing source.

How to use Jad. To decompile a single JAVA class file 'example1.class'. type the following: jad example1.class. This command creates file 'example1.jad' in the current directory. If such file already exists Jad asks whether you want to overwrite it or not. Option -o permits overwriting without a confirmation.Jul 7, 2011 · 3 Answers. You need a Java Development Kit (JDK). This includes a Java compiler (usually named javac ), and an jar archiver. Assuming you have the java files in a directory names src (then according to their package structure), you would use. javac -d classdir -sourcepath src src/*.java src/*/*.java src/*/*/*.java ... to compile all files. Some of the popularly used java decompilers are: 1. JDProject. JD Project supports Java 5 and later versions. Written in C++, so it is efficient and faster. It operates as a standalone utility as it is independent of JRE (Java Runtime Environment). It is a free tool for non-commercial use.It includes JD-Core, JD-GUI, JD-Eclipse and JD-IntelliJ. Java Decompiler 사이트에 들어가셔서 JD-GUI의 Download 버튼을 누르시면 운영체제 별로 실행파일을 다운로드 받을 수 있습니다. 프로그램을 실행하면 다음과 같은 화면이 보이며, 파일 열기 아이콘을 눌러 디컴파일하려는 JAR 파일을 선택합니다. Jun 29, 2021 · The Enhanced Class Decompiler plugin can choose the following five Java decompiler tools to decompile the Java class without source code. JD; Jad; FernFlower; CFR; Procyon; P.S I choose FernFlower, because the IntelliJ IDEA also using FernFlower to decompile Java class. 2. How to install Enhanced Class Decompiler plugin. Below are the steps to ...

Dec 26, 2022 · I download and extract the Java decompiler JD-GUI. I have a Java JDK installed from my Linux distribution, I download the newest Java JDK 19 from Oracle. I d...

JD Java decompiler (freeware) looks nice, but it made a lot of mistakes with variable declarations (some declarations were missing, other were placed badly) Neshkov DJ Java Decompiler (shareware) also looks nice, the code produced by it contained less syntax errors then JD, but the code was not …

A 2-in-1 JAVA decompiler based on JD-CORE v0 and v1 . Initially a duo of decompilers were supported (JD-Core v0 & v1), but now other decompilers are supported with the transformer-api project. JD-Core v0 and v1 are 2 different decompilers rather than 2 different versions of the same one. They use a different algorithm :Procyon is a Java decompiler written in Java, and it can be called directly from Java code. For example: com.strobel.decompiler.Decompiler.decompile(. "W:\\Hello.class", new com.strobel.decompiler.PlainTextOutput(writer) ); writer.flush(); There is also a decompile () overload that accepts a DecompilerSettings instance, …1. Java Decompiler JD Overview. Java Decompiler JD is a decompiler for the Java programming language. JD Java Decompiler is provided as a GUI Tool, as Core …Online decompiler for Java, Android, Python and C#. De compiler. com. JAR String Editor; Release Notes; [email protected]; Drop EXE or DLL, JAR or CLASS, APK, XAPK or DEX, PYC or PYO, LUAC or LUB, SMX or AMXX file here Choose file. Upload your artifact. Drag and drop your artifact into the online … 2. DJ Java Decompiler (UI for JAD) The DJ Java decompiler is a windows based decompiler that constructs a Java source code from the compiled binary class file. It acts as a GUI (Graphical User Interface) for JAD decompilers. It was developed by Atanas Nehskov. Its last release came in August 2011. Java 6 / 7 Decompiling Command Line. I'm aware that part of this has been asked before however my search continues empty handed. Currently I'm using JD-Gui to decompile jar files and have switched to fernflower but it seems to have issues with enumeration, will not decompile specific classes by throwing an NPE.

1. Java Decompiler JD Overview. Java Decompiler JD is a decompiler for the Java programming language. JD Java Decompiler is provided as a GUI Tool, as Core …Nov 30, 2020 · Select "Java Decompiler Eclipse Plug-in", Click -> Next -> Finish, Accept the warning as, it is because "org.jd.ide.eclipse.plugin_2.0.0.jar" is not signed. Click on "Install Anyway" Eclipse needs to be restarted. 25 Mar 2013 ... Is there any open source Java Decompilers for Ubuntu, preferably in the repositories and/or GPL'ed? Both JAD and JD, the most popular ...When it comes to vehicle valuation, JD Power NADA values are one of the most reliable and accurate sources available. This comprehensive system provides an in-depth look at a vehic...This is due to the fact that the decompiler is unable to accurately recreate the exact source code used to create the compiled program. The decompiled code is also not optimized and may include redundant code or extra variables. Frequently Asked Questions Is this decompiler better than JD java decompiler? Equally good.KEY INSIGHTS. Java Decompilers are essential for reverse engineering bytecode into readable Java source code, offering debugging opportunities. Emphasizes Decompilation Accuracy and Support for Multiple Java Versions, a robust decompiler should handle various bytecode structures. Choice between Graphical User Interface …Simply drag and drop to decompile and search Java Jars & Android APKs; File format support for: Class, Jar, XAPK, APK, DEX, WAR, JSP, Image Resources, Text Resources & More; 6 Built-in Java decompilers: Krakatau, CFR, Procyon, FernFlower, JADX, JD-GUI; 3 Built-in Bytecode disassemblers, including 2 …

In recent years, there has been a growing emphasis on sustainability in the fashion industry. Consumers are becoming more conscious of the environmental impact of their clothing ch...

Dec 25, 2019 · JD-Core 1.1.1. This release includes the following changes: Addition of a part of the test protocol described in this research paper : The Strengths and Behavioral Quirks of Java Bytecode Decompilers. Improved recompilation of decompiled source codes. Decompiling and recompiling org.apache.commons:commons-collections4:4.1 without any errors. When it comes to finding stylish and flattering dresses for women of all sizes, JD Williams is a brand that stands out. With a wide range of options available, they have become a g...Here are the best Java Decompilers that you can use. Also, Read: 5 Best IDE for Java Programmers. Best Java Decompilers. 1. JD Project. Java Decompiler project was majorly developed for decompiling Java 5 bytecode and other versions that came later. The decompiler can be used on three major operating systems which are …JD-IntelliJ is a Java decompiler for the IntelliJ IDEA. Open a Java class file to see the decompiled code. It is based on the famous JD-GUI's core library JD-Core...java.contentProvider.preferred (settings.json only): the ID of a decompiler to use. Currently, fernflower, cfr and procyon are supported. Defaults to fernflower. java.decompiler.[id] (replace [id] with the ID of the decompiler you wish to configure): additional configuration to provide to the decompiler. The format depends on the chosen decompiler.18 May 2021 ... JD-core provides some core functions of decompilation, and also provides a separate Class decompilation method, but if you want to directly ...JD-GUI is a standalone graphical utility that displays Java source codes of ".class" files. You can browse the reconstructed source code with the JD-GUI for instant access to methods and fields. How to build JD-GUI ?The Java Decompiler project aims to develop tools in order to decompile and analyze Java 5 byte code and later versions. JD-GUI is a standalone graphical utility that displays Java source codes of .class files. You can browse the reconstructed source code with the JD-GUI for instant access to methods and fields.5. Not working with STS 4.4. #35 opened on Apr 17, 2020 by hitesh85. 1. jd-eclipse插件安装失败. #34 opened on Mar 3, 2020 by ccsamawudi. 安装jd插件后,class,那两个文件也配置了,报错The class file is not on the classpath. #33 opened on Oct 27, 2019 by liu525727321. 2.Vineflower. #. Vineflower is a modern Java decompiler aiming to be as accurate as possible, while not sacrificing the readability of the generated code. Vineflower supports modern Java (J20+), automatic reformatting of output code, and multithreaded decompilation. The main repository for Vineflower is located on …

Nov 13, 2013 · JD Java decompiler (freeware) looks nice, but it made a lot of mistakes with variable declarations (some declarations were missing, other were placed badly) Neshkov DJ Java Decompiler (shareware) also looks nice, the code produced by it contained less syntax errors then JD, but the code was not working. Given the product is not free, one would ...

JD-core official website: https://java-decompiler.github.io/ JD-core is an independent Java library that can be used for Java decompilation and supports bytecode decompilation from Java 1 to Java 12, including Lambda expressions, method references, default methods, etc. The well-known JD-GUI and Eclipse seamless integration …

Nov 17, 2023 · For example, to use the JD-GUI Java Decompiler, you simply open the .class or .jar file with JD-GUI, and it will show you the decompiled source code. Common pitfalls and how to avoid them; Java Decompiling is not a perfect process and there are a few pitfalls that you should be aware of. Here are a few tips and tricks to keep in mind: 1. This is due to the fact that the decompiler is unable to accurately recreate the exact source code used to create the compiled program. The decompiled code is also not optimized and may include redundant code or extra variables. Frequently Asked Questions Is this decompiler better than JD java decompiler? Equally good.When it comes to finding stylish and flattering dresses for women of all sizes, JD Williams is a brand that stands out. With a wide range of options available, they have become a g...4 Aug 2014 ... 11:00 · Go to channel · How to decompile JAR by JD GUI Tool | Java Decompiler | Open Source Decompiler UI Tool. TechTalk Debu•8.9K views · 75&nb...31 Mar 2021 ... In this video, we will download and install jd-gui which is used to decompile java classes or jar files Download link ...With the increasing popularity of online shopping, JD Sports has made it easier than ever for customers to find and purchase their favorite sports apparel and footwear from the com...30 Apr 2023 ... Android : using java decompiler jd-gui and getting // INTERNAL ERROR // To Access My Live Chat Page, On Google, Search for "hows tech ...Use JD-CLI. JD-CLI is used for single command line statements. Only a single command is needed to decompile a class file. This is the command used to decompile a class file: java - jar jd - cli.jar[class - file] We can download this decompiler by clicking here: intoolswetrust/jd-cli: Command Line Java …1 Answer. Sorted by: 3. I extracted the library manually using below comment in command prompt. jar xf myFile.jar. I opened the extracted folder in JD-GUI, it gave me the decompiled version of both main and inner class in single file. Note: Earlier I opened library directly in JD-GUI in that case it didn't show me inner class at all.DJ Java Decompiler; JReversePro; JODE; JD-CORE/ JD-GUI/ JD Eclipse; JAD Decompiler. The JAD is a command-line application. It is written in C++. The main function is to disassemble the .class files. JAD can be deployed from the console, and it will decompile Java classes into the source code. This way, developers …Sorted by: 10. follow these steps: Create an eclipse project. add the jar as a dependency to that project. Create a new class named ScreenCapture.java in the package screencapture. copy the whole source from your JD too view the screenshot of which u attached here. change the code which u want. build the project.

Are you looking to start your journey in Java programming? With the right resources and guidance, you can learn the fundamentals of Java programming and become a certified programm...Nov 13, 2013 · JD Java decompiler (freeware) looks nice, but it made a lot of mistakes with variable declarations (some declarations were missing, other were placed badly) Neshkov DJ Java Decompiler (shareware) also looks nice, the code produced by it contained less syntax errors then JD, but the code was not working. Given the product is not free, one would ... 1 Answer. Take a look at Java Decompiler. It allows you to decompile jar files with the JD-GUI and browse the class files as source. Here is another stackoverflow question. It even has an eclipse plugin and works seamlessly while opening class files where source code is not available. You can even use Java Decompiler to save the …Instagram:https://instagram. mould on ceiling bathroomrain pants ladiestile in linear drainbravo real housewives of nyc 4 Aug 2011 ... JD-GUI - Fast Java Decompiler Download | Read more hacking news on The Hacker News cybersecurity news website and learn how to protect ... changing hot water heatermonopoly go free dice links scopely Simply drag and drop to decompile and search Java Jars & Android APKs; File format support for: Class, Jar, XAPK, APK, DEX, WAR, JSP, Image Resources, Text Resources & More; 6 Built-in Java decompilers: Krakatau, CFR, Procyon, FernFlower, JADX, JD-GUI; 3 Built-in Bytecode disassemblers, including 2 …Jul 7, 2011 · 3 Answers. You need a Java Development Kit (JDK). This includes a Java compiler (usually named javac ), and an jar archiver. Assuming you have the java files in a directory names src (then according to their package structure), you would use. javac -d classdir -sourcepath src src/*.java src/*/*.java src/*/*/*.java ... to compile all files. trophy maker Jan 16, 2013 · You can use JD-GUI to decompile jar files and save the whole lot into a source zip file which can then be added to the source search list (via Configure Build Path). The problem with JD-GUI is that the line numbers are out which makes debugging very difficult, so you need to. extract the source files from the decompiled source zip file How to decompile .jar file or how to decompile a .class file?How to decompile a .class file in eclipse IDE? How to Install and use JD-Eclipse plugin & How t...0. Find a decompiler which can make your job using from cmd command, then gather all your JAR files in some folder. The next step is to build a minimum java program which takes them all and using this cmd above by executing it to some other folder. There is a Java code for executing exe files same as manual command line.